The name Analy has seen a varied trend of popularity over the past few decades in the United States. In the late 1980s and early 1990s, the number of births with the name Analy fluctuated between five to forty-four per year.
However, starting around the year 2005, there was a significant increase in the popularity of the name Analy. Between 2005 and 2013, the number of annual births with the name Analy rose steadily from seventy-one to one hundred and fifty-seven. This represents an approximate five-fold increase over the course of nine years.
Despite this growth, the name Analy has not become one of the most popular names in the United States. From 2014 onwards, the number of births with the name Analy has hovered around sixty to ninety-five per year, indicating that while it may be gaining some traction, it remains a relatively uncommon name.
In total, there have been two thousand one hundred and thirty births with the name Analy in the United States since 1986. This demonstrates that while the name may not be ubiquitous, it has nonetheless been chosen for over two thousand babies born in the country over the past three-and-a-half decades.
